At 8:25p.m. EST, TWA Flight 841 departed JFK International after a 45-minute delay due to traffic congestion and reached its initial cruising altitude of 35,000feet at 8:54p.m. Due to a 100-knot headwind, the pilots requested to climb to 39,000feet at 9:25p.m., which was granted. At 9:49p.m., after traveling nearly 540 miles (870km),[2] while cruising at 39,000 feet (12,000m) near the city of Saginaw, Michigan, Captain Harvey "Hoot" Gibson (44),[3] said the aircraft was operating with the autopilot on "Altitude Hold" mode when he felt a light buffeting of the airframe. On April 4, 1979, TWA Flight 841 departed New York John F. Kennedy Airport (JFK) for MinneapolisSaint Paul International Airport (MSP) in Minnesota.
